Finding inner strength from "summary" of Heavy by Kiese Laymon

In our lives, we often find ourselves in situations that require us to dig deep and tap into our inner reserves of strength. This inner strength is not always easy to find, especially when we are faced with challenges that seem insurmountable. However, it is during these difficult times that we must search within ourselves for the courage and resilience to keep moving forward. Finding inner strength is a process that involves self-reflection and self-awareness. It requires us to confront our fears, insecurities, and vulnerabilities in order to overcome them. It is about acknowledging our weaknesses and imperfections, and learning to accept and embrace them as part of who we are. In his memoir "Heavy," Kiese Laymon explores the concept of inner strength through his own personal journey of self-discovery and healing. He shares his struggles with addiction, weight issues, and trauma, and how he was able to find the strength within himself to confront these challenges head-on. Laymon's story serves as a powerful reminder that inner strength is not about being invincible or perfect. It is about being vulnerable, honest, and willing to face our demons. It is about finding the courage to ask for help when we need it, and the resilience to keep going even when the odds are stacked against us.
  1. Finding inner strength is a continuous process of growth and self-improvement. It is about learning to trust ourselves, our instincts, and our abilities, even in the face of adversity. It is about realizing that we are capable of overcoming whatever obstacles life throws our way, as long as we believe in ourselves and never give up.
